[0017] like figure 1As shown, a kind of aseptic combustion power generation system of water surface garbage in a hydropower station in the present invention includes a garbage storage bin, a sterilization room, a cutting system, a mixing mixer, a compressor, a drying room, a granulator, a fuel bin, And the combustion chamber, the garbage is transported to the sterilization room, and the garbage is subjected to forced sterilization and disinfection in the sterilization room. After the quarantine reaches the standard, the garbage is transported to the cutting system through the conveyor belt. Abstract

The invention discloses an aseptic combustion power generation system for water surface garbage in a hydropower station, which includes a garbage storage bin, a sterilization room, a cutting system, a mixing mixer, a compressor, a drying room, a granulator, a fuel bin, a combustion chamber, and a fuel bin , adhesive silos, boilers, and steam turbines, and the flue gas is discharged through the chimney. The invention turns garbage into new fuel, which not only meets the requirements of hygienic production, but also purifies the follow-up environment of garbage treatment, turns garbage into new fuel, forms fine fuel with uniform specifications, and transports it to the fuel bunker. A certain feed rate puts fuel particles into the combustion chamber. After the fuel is burned, it generates heat and makes the boiler generate steam, which drives the steam turbine to rotate and generate electricity, and converts the garbage that pollutes the environment into fuel for combustion. technical field [0001] The invention relates to a garbage treatment system, in particular to a power generation system for aseptic combustion of water surface garbage in a hydropower station. Background technique [0002] Hydropower stations rely on hydropower to generate electricity. China has many rivers such as the Yangtze River, the Yellow River, and the Lancang River, which are used for relatively abundant hydropower resources in the world. The construction of hydropower stations has always been the main source of energy. With the expansion of human life, modern More and more traces of life are scattered to various places, and more and more domestic garbage, production and natural garbage flow into ditches and rivers with rainwater, and finally accumulate in front of the dams of hydropower stations, forming quite Spectacular garbage dump.
